Quite simply the best meal I’ve had. Scallops to start and octopus which was just amazing. Then I had ravioli filled with seafood and my date had the clam linguini. Followed by a shared tiramisu and coffees. Lovely bottle of wine in such a lovely atmosphere. Originally my date ordered the mussels but the owner came over and advised that the chef didn’t think they looked great so he wouldn’t serve them. That’s service. Paid more for a meal before but this was by far a great experience

Ended up stopping here for dinner with a medium-sized group before seeing the Christmas Carrol. The ambiance is very nice. It feels upscale without being pretentious. I especially liked the architecture, it makes you feel like you're having dinner in a place of historic significance and not just another restaurant. We ordered wine and a few appetizers, and I got the chicken cannelloni. The wine that the server recommended was perfect with the food that we ordered and I appreciated his recommendation. The apps were delicious and so was my entrée. All the food tasted like very good, no-nonsense, high-quality Italian food and I believe the menu items were priced very fairly. It can be difficult to find good local food in Galveston, but my company along with myself cleaned our plates and even finished the remaining apps before leaving here. If you're looking for an upscale Italian spot in a beautiful historic Galveston building, definitely check out Riondo's Ristorante.
